NOTE :  
1. The K9F12XXX0A may include invalid blocks when first shipped. Additional invalid blocks may develop while being used. The number of valid blocks  
is presented with both cases of invalid blocks considered. Invalid blocks are defined as blocks that contain one or more bad bits. Do not erase or  
program factory-marked bad blocks. Refer to the attached technical notes for a appropriate management of invalid blocks.  
2. The 1st block, which is placed on 00h block address, is fully guaranteed to be a valid block, does not require Error Correction.  
3. Minimum 1004 valid blocks are guaranteed for each contiguous 128Mb memory space.
